THE world's first nuclear power station designed primarily for the generation of electricity and owned by an electricity supply authority, is to be built for England's Central Electricity Authority by the AEI-John Thompson Nuclear Energy Company Ltd.
The contract, valued at £36 t -C40 million, is for building a complete station on a site at Berkeley, Gloucestershire, 101 the estuary of the river Seven, with und was awarded in competition

AGRICULTURAL machinery manufacturers in the United Kingdom regard it as part of their service to customers to provide instruction in tho maintenance and operation of the equipment they sell.

In recent months students from India, Pakistan, the Unton of South Africa, Malya; New Zealand and Thailand have been trained at the school.
The Massey-Harris-Ferguson school of farm mechanisation at Stoneleigh Abbey gives Instruc tion each year to somo 780 students from over 100 different countries.
